The utilization of natural gas reserves with high carbon dioxide (co2) content poses an enrichment problem that requires separation. in addition, the proposed use of co2 for enhanced oil recovery creates further need to characterize the vapor-liquid equilibrium properties of ch4-co2 mixtures. cryogenic distillation has been proposed at low temperatures (< -50 oc) and pressures below 4 mpa, where the formation of solid co2 is possible. investigate the vapor-liquid equilibrium behavior for the ch4-co2 mixture for mixtures containing 10, 30, 50, 80 mol% ch4. one source for experimental data for the ch4-co2 system is mraw, hwang, and kobayashi, journal of chemical engineering data, vol. 23 (2), p. 135 (1978). compare the phase equilibrium boundaries by using the peng robinson and soave-redlick-kwang equations of states and also adjusting the binary interactions parameter (kij) so that the model predictions match as closely as possible to existing experimental data.
